在信息技术飞速发展的今天,操作系统作为连接硬件与软件的基石,其架构的先进性与设计的合理性直接决定了计算生态的活力与上限。当我们审视当前主流操作系统时,往往会发现它们在追求通用性与兼容性的过程中,不可避免地背负了历史包袱,形成了复杂的层级与冗余的抽象。而近期备受关注的DeltaOS,则以其独特的架构理念与清晰的设计哲学,试图对现代操作系统进行一次从底层逻辑到顶层体验的“重新定义”。这并非一次简单的功能叠加或性能优化,而是一场旨在从根本上提升效率、安全性与适应性的系统性革新。
DeltaOS创新架构的核心,首先体现在其颠覆性的“微内核与模块化服务”设计。与传统宏内核系统将大量核心功能(如文件系统、设备驱动、网络协议栈)紧密集成在内核空间不同,DeltaOS采用了一个极度精简的微内核,仅负责最基础的进程调度、内存管理和进程间通信(IPC)。其他所有系统服务,均以独立的、运行在用户空间的“服务模块”形式存在。这种设计的革命性在于,它将系统的复杂性从内核中剥离,极大地提升了内核的稳定性和安全性。单个服务模块的故障或遭受攻击,可以被严格隔离,不会导致整个系统崩溃或权限沦陷。同时,模块化的架构赋予了DeltaOS前所未有的灵活性,开发者可以根据特定场景(如物联网终端、边缘计算节点、高性能服务器)像搭积木一样定制所需的系统服务集合,去除不必要的组件,从而实现极致的资源优化和性能表现。
DeltaOS引入了名为“能力基安全”(Capability-Based Security)的深层安全模型。在这一模型中,所有系统资源(如文件、设备、内存区域)都被抽象为“能力”对象,进程对资源的任何访问,都必须持有对应的、不可伪造的“能力令牌”。这与传统操作系统基于用户身份(UID/GID)和访问控制列表(ACL)的“访问请求-权限检查”模式有本质区别。在DeltaOS中,权限不再是与身份静态绑定的属性,而是作为动态传递的、最小化的令牌。这意味着,恶意代码即使侵入某个进程,也无法获取该进程未持有的能力令牌,从而将攻击面限制在极小的范围内。这种从“默认允许”到“默认拒绝”的根本转变,为构建高可信的计算环境提供了坚实的底层支撑。
在性能与响应方面,DeltaOS的架构优势同样显著。其微内核设计与高度优化的IPC机制,使得系统调用和跨进程通信的延迟大幅降低。更为关键的是,DeltaOS针对现代多核与异构计算硬件(如CPU、GPU、NPU)进行了原生优化,提出了“统一资源视图”和“智能调度策略”。操作系统能够以更细的粒度感知和管理不同类型的计算单元,并根据任务特性(计算密集型、IO密集型、实时性要求)进行智能的任务分配与迁移,充分挖掘硬件潜力。对于需要确定性和低延迟的实时任务,DeltaOS提供了专属的调度保障,使其能够在复杂的通用计算环境中依然满足工业控制、自动驾驶等领域的严苛要求。
DeltaOS在开发者体验与生态构建上也展现了前瞻性。它提供了一套清晰、一致的API接口,这套接口基于现代编程语言的设计思想,力求简洁与表达力。同时,通过兼容层技术,DeltaOS能够在模块化架构之上,有选择地兼容主流操作系统(如Linux)的应用程序二进制接口(ABI),这为生态的平滑过渡和初期应用迁移提供了可行路径。开发者既可以享受DeltaOS新架构带来的高性能与高安全红利,又能在一定范围内利用现有的丰富软件资源,降低了开发和部署的门槛。
当然,任何操作系统的成功,最终都离不开生态的繁荣。DeltaOS面临的挑战在于,如何吸引足够多的硬件厂商、软件开发者和终端用户,共同构建一个围绕其新架构的良性循环。其模块化设计既是优势,也对软件的分发、依赖管理和系统配置提出了新的要求。这需要配套的开发工具链、软件包管理体系和社区支持。
DeltaOS并非又一个在既有范式上的改良产品,它代表了一种对操作系统本质的重新思考与大胆实践。通过微内核与模块化服务构建的坚实基底,通过能力基安全模型构筑的深层防线,通过对现代及未来硬件架构的原生适配,以及对开发者友好的设计理念,DeltaOS描绘了一幅更高效、更安全、更灵活的计算平台蓝图。它的出现,为陷入某种同质化竞争的操作系统领域注入了新的变量和可能性。尽管前路漫漫,生态构建非一日之功,但其架构所指向的方向——一个更简洁、更可靠、更能适应多元化计算场景的系统未来,无疑值得整个行业的密切关注与深入探索。其成败与否,或将深刻影响下一个计算时代的生态格局。
原创文章,作者:XiaoWen,如若转载,请注明出处:https://www.zhujizhentan.com/a/3865